Yann Leboulanger
c0d7d3cb0b
add default affiliation
2005-10-04 12:21:16 +00:00
Yann Leboulanger
f1dd5657f5
[fishface] we can set a list of word that cause the message to be highlighted
...
we have sound in gc (for the moment it's the same than in normal chat until I find/make others)
2005-10-04 12:19:18 +00:00
Yann Leboulanger
4f30b67d9e
add a NS in xmpp
2005-10-04 11:51:54 +00:00
Yann Leboulanger
4d8fd1dfc3
we now support MSN conferences
2005-10-04 11:33:57 +00:00
Yann Leboulanger
59b2bf1d31
xmpp code in connection.py instead of gajim.py
2005-10-04 10:59:11 +00:00
Yann Leboulanger
c4e9be83cd
refactor a var
2005-10-04 10:49:58 +00:00
Yann Leboulanger
eab959790e
account nam entry in account modification window is 100% width
2005-10-04 07:35:11 +00:00
Yann Leboulanger
ed5d983081
on dubble click on a row in accounts window, we open modify account
2005-10-04 07:12:30 +00:00
Nikos Kouremenos
83ffab141f
fix a tb
2005-10-03 20:17:55 +00:00
Nikos Kouremenos
7671dae8b8
missing import
2005-10-03 18:27:39 +00:00
Nikos Kouremenos
f6470778a6
we now show a happy dialog on nick conflict asking (and even proposing new nick); also refactor code and add a new gtkgui helper
2005-10-03 18:19:31 +00:00
Nikos Kouremenos
11d3316af2
remove duplicate line
2005-10-03 17:34:03 +00:00
Nikos Kouremenos
5c61b2de72
remove assert
2005-10-03 17:21:48 +00:00
Nikos Kouremenos
e41bbd657d
typo
2005-10-03 17:03:59 +00:00
Nikos Kouremenos
6899985d5c
we now cache avatar, so we only ask once. TODO: ask, store and show in roster; TODO2: on new sha reask vcard to get new avatar
2005-10-03 16:14:41 +00:00
Nikos Kouremenos
7518d20bf7
show avatar window in mouse pos
2005-10-03 12:30:18 +00:00
Nikos Kouremenos
df5e7775d0
2 lines now one
2005-10-03 10:38:05 +00:00
Nikos Kouremenos
6ae41cddef
mouseover avatar now show avatar in normal size; adding some FIXMES. Yann please look at the return 0 one
2005-10-03 01:40:56 +00:00
Nikos Kouremenos
4220da24aa
successfully (2 l) and say in sectext what vCard is about; also imporve a fixme (still fixme)
2005-10-02 21:56:38 +00:00
Nikos Kouremenos
290728f770
[delmonico] a fix for wizard
2005-10-02 13:12:23 +00:00
Alex Mauer
6dbafc84cf
Show our own priority in self tooltip instead of the default '5'
2005-10-01 03:54:44 +00:00
Nikos Kouremenos
6cc565063d
fix string; add fixme
2005-09-30 20:27:57 +00:00
Nikos Kouremenos
4765c32b92
fix string
2005-09-30 18:21:31 +00:00
Yann Leboulanger
76e0838c81
forbid a user to join a room when he is invisible
2005-09-30 17:52:25 +00:00
Yann Leboulanger
b72776ff9d
automaticaly begin editing of newly added theme
2005-09-30 17:16:17 +00:00
Yann Leboulanger
c0ccc81252
detect gc presences in a batter way
2005-09-28 15:24:26 +00:00
Yann Leboulanger
a8117faf2d
[gjc] "interrupt system call" are now handled and cause the function to be retried
2005-09-28 15:00:01 +00:00
Yann Leboulanger
42ffc5d810
remove the contact_mutual_removal advanced option and add a checkbutton in remove_contact dialog to ask if we want to remove both subscriptions
2005-09-28 14:35:06 +00:00
Nikos Kouremenos
41fd150b93
confrimation dilaogs have QUESTION and not WARNING
2005-09-28 14:20:51 +00:00
Yann Leboulanger
1942ac9e73
get var before using it
2005-09-27 11:14:39 +00:00
Nikos Kouremenos
1fff71ad87
refactor to allow changing our nick after nick conflict but first #967 needs to be fixed so I can test
2005-09-26 22:29:52 +00:00
Nikos Kouremenos
04d82ec3fc
wrap license
2005-09-26 13:06:11 +00:00
Nikos Kouremenos
a4cb65366b
add a decode
2005-09-25 19:00:14 +00:00
Nikos Kouremenos
e3b340a430
fix a fixme
2005-09-25 18:37:50 +00:00
Nikos Kouremenos
2cf952a43e
alt+c
2005-09-25 14:02:54 +00:00
Nikos Kouremenos
4e97beaa84
80 chars
2005-09-24 21:50:58 +00:00
Nikos Kouremenos
35758a4266
add a transl comment
2005-09-24 21:49:28 +00:00
Nikos Kouremenos
f07d4eba1a
do not deprecatewarning if gp 2.12
2005-09-24 12:51:30 +00:00
Nikos Kouremenos
97f4cef06b
get_type becomes get_message_type so it is self-explanatory
2005-09-24 11:35:56 +00:00
Yann Leboulanger
a591be7cd2
remove already discused fixme: we don't receive this info (the nick)
2005-09-24 10:25:25 +00:00
Yann Leboulanger
ca31a398a4
systary tooltip now shows the number of chat/single_chat/gc/pm unread messages
2005-09-24 10:24:14 +00:00
Yann Leboulanger
38f867f181
refactor code
2005-09-24 10:00:00 +00:00
Yann Leboulanger
63449d5f9d
remove unusefull code
2005-09-24 09:59:34 +00:00
Yann Leboulanger
63c890da2b
systray.add_jid and systray.remove_jid now have another argument: the typ of message: ('gc' or 'chat' or 'single_chat' or 'pm')
...
systary now can handle pm messages
2005-09-24 09:42:10 +00:00
Yann Leboulanger
8cc1bd3cea
count unread_messages in gc correctly when we have unread pm
2005-09-23 21:25:20 +00:00
Yann Leboulanger
8f93012465
groupchat_window now has an on_message function that can hold pm in queues so they are not printed (systray is not handled yet)
2005-09-23 21:01:42 +00:00
Nikos Kouremenos
89d170c8b4
make keys strings unicode instance strings
2005-09-23 18:49:51 +00:00
Yann Leboulanger
258ee85e79
typo
2005-09-22 19:18:53 +00:00
Nikos Kouremenos
091211434e
say to the user what is wrong (if missing libglade)
2005-09-22 16:30:46 +00:00
Yann Leboulanger
49cef57a9d
fix TB when an account is online when we show account tooltip
2005-09-22 15:53:27 +00:00
Nikos Kouremenos
a286f42b34
cleanup
2005-09-22 15:15:39 +00:00
Yann Leboulanger
5ea343182c
do not hide the roster when we press esc if a row is selected
2005-09-22 15:13:37 +00:00
Nikos Kouremenos
85b1dcd9a4
not the path, just the name, or else bold makes it huge
2005-09-22 11:35:59 +00:00
Yann Leboulanger
84bc2dde2f
add the type of row in gc roster
2005-09-22 07:42:08 +00:00
Yann Leboulanger
6edd7ca43e
import i18n before we use it
2005-09-21 14:42:29 +00:00
Travis Shirk
4a7888d9d3
Added an assert to track down the FIXME
2005-09-21 03:23:01 +00:00
Travis Shirk
238cc2171c
Check for GtkTreeIter in selection tuple before using to lookup option; closes #893
2005-09-21 03:19:45 +00:00
Yann Leboulanger
e39f1a30e8
hide window when we press esc if we have systray
2005-09-20 19:57:34 +00:00
Yann Leboulanger
bc25dbef03
split NOTIFY event into NOTIFY and GC_NOTIFY
2005-09-20 18:36:28 +00:00
Travis Shirk
83aa034a24
Abide by composing-only chatstate configuration; closes #945
2005-09-20 18:33:11 +00:00
Nikos Kouremenos
a7ee9425be
do it in an easier way
2005-09-20 18:30:21 +00:00
Nikos Kouremenos
8017a9d3cb
comment
2005-09-20 18:12:39 +00:00
Nikos Kouremenos
8307a86eae
fix cb
2005-09-20 18:08:26 +00:00
Nikos Kouremenos
8cceb3b2f8
position the menu below the actions button
2005-09-20 18:05:57 +00:00
Nikos Kouremenos
39e278cbe3
add an arrow to the actions button. let us all drink to GTK+ devs who restrict their code to toolbars
2005-09-20 14:58:54 +00:00
Yann Leboulanger
569a746443
exception dialog resizable (thx aldafu)
2005-09-20 11:30:53 +00:00
Nikos Kouremenos
5a6e12e562
cleaning UI of TC p1: lamp button (with text it's big, without text it can confuse users very much) is removed in favor of the already there menuitem in actions
2005-09-20 11:10:28 +00:00
Travis Shirk
7c1679eae7
Fixed a bug whereby chatstates were disable incorrectly with the following scenario:
...
client #1 : send client #2 a message (state is ask)
client #2 : recv's message and set's chatstate active since the message used JEP 85
client #1 : sends another message, but since client #2 has not responded yet it sends not chatstate
client #2 : recv's message and set's chatstate to False because JEP 85 was not used
(Note, if client #2 would have responded after the first message chatstates would be in effect.
2005-09-20 02:24:25 +00:00
Travis Shirk
075c5bfc48
Per JEP-0085 updates, losing focus does not immediately result in inactive
...
http://article.gmane.org/gmane.network.jabber.standards-jig/8924
2005-09-20 01:57:54 +00:00
Yann Leboulanger
7ea237d8ea
typo
2005-09-19 16:27:10 +00:00
Yann Leboulanger
97b75de35b
split NOTIFY event into NOTIFY and GC_NOTIFY
2005-09-19 16:13:45 +00:00
Dimitur Kirov
619ffb95a8
call save_config on each change
2005-09-19 15:44:46 +00:00
Dimitur Kirov
95d771b138
added GTK+ theme as default theme.
...
faster roster repaint method (change_roster_style)
fixes on themes list logic.
2005-09-19 15:23:18 +00:00
Dimitur Kirov
ded6e77d50
typo
2005-09-19 13:51:13 +00:00
Yann Leboulanger
6d0bf25adc
SRV lookup moved from xmpp to connection.py
2005-09-18 19:52:06 +00:00
Yann Leboulanger
a7f4391083
fix indentation
2005-09-18 19:49:08 +00:00
Nikos Kouremenos
c2a6350adf
fixes
2005-09-18 18:34:14 +00:00
Nikos Kouremenos
0be58af7ad
FirstTimeWizard: add functionlity for servers button, fix comment for code to have space after #, fix comments and other coding styles, add pango me fixmes, add more and better strings
2005-09-18 18:30:16 +00:00
Nikos Kouremenos
5eea887c43
[delmonico] First Time User Wizard is in!
2005-09-18 15:03:04 +00:00
Nikos Kouremenos
ae1e9a0cbf
remove problematic on_command and make it command
2005-09-17 12:18:47 +00:00
Nikos Kouremenos
488c24e5e5
fix 2 strings [thanks Juracy]
2005-09-17 11:34:39 +00:00
Nikos Kouremenos
c60d7d9239
thanks gjc
2005-09-17 11:29:05 +00:00
Nikos Kouremenos
599e8d15a4
add two more ft proxies until we get to autodiscover if the server we have the JID on, has support and we prio on that
2005-09-17 11:26:15 +00:00
Dimitur Kirov
223a2627b5
save prefs only on theme_manager destroy.
...
fixed bug in groupfontattr(s). tooglebuttons
are loaded with theme
2005-09-17 09:37:40 +00:00
Dimitur Kirov
159a4dad42
prevent NoneType TB if fontattrs are not set
2005-09-17 08:42:37 +00:00
Dimitur Kirov
8e2dd60449
set font of the tv render with the new font
...
attributes
2005-09-17 08:34:55 +00:00
Dimitur Kirov
7be5abe6e4
don't show style in the fontselector
2005-09-17 08:34:07 +00:00
Dimitur Kirov
37f3af1139
added get_theme_font_for_option function
2005-09-17 08:32:55 +00:00
Dimitur Kirov
57de1dc5ac
support font attributes (weight and style)
2005-09-17 08:31:29 +00:00
Dimitur Kirov
69557c85d7
added proxy65.unstable.nl to list of our
...
proxies. Theme fonts have new property:
XXX_fontattrs
2005-09-17 08:29:35 +00:00
Dimitur Kirov
c4c34bee9f
make theme manager work with new layout
2005-09-16 21:32:57 +00:00
Dimitur Kirov
af9d242bc1
check for default color
2005-09-16 21:30:30 +00:00
Dimitur Kirov
d9d673bec6
new theme manger layout
2005-09-16 21:30:00 +00:00
Yann Leboulanger
22a4f36ab7
fix a TB
2005-09-16 15:30:42 +00:00
Yann Leboulanger
67c9312d37
SRV lookup is now an option and is turned off when we use SSL
2005-09-16 15:19:01 +00:00
Nikos Kouremenos
eb7d3cc381
fix a tb
2005-09-16 15:18:35 +00:00
Alex Mauer
f7f5bab8fb
Whoops, didn't mean to commit that.
2005-09-16 00:14:18 +00:00
Alex Mauer
3da22df9c1
* Add comment explaining logic of displaying join_gc window
...
* correct grammar regression
2005-09-16 00:12:46 +00:00
Yann Leboulanger
d05728fc55
fix stupid error :)
2005-09-15 21:26:15 +00:00
Dimitur Kirov
71231fb864
don't load remote control if dbus is 0.23.x
...
and python is 2.4
2005-09-15 20:40:55 +00:00